Index of /upload/iblock/738
Name
Last modified
Size
Description
Parent Directory
-
flj8w2w51prol459pffu5sgd2bpvehz4.jpg
2026-01-19 22:13
165K
uxmh6y01jkuwr0k32a6ocrp9og2ohfu6.jpg
2026-01-07 16:17
340K
Apache/2.4.25 (Debian) Server at aviqa.ru Port 80